ActionAid is an international anti-poverty agency formed in 1972. We are a partnership between people in poor and rich countries working together to end poverty and injustice. Today we are working with over 13 million of the world’s poorest and excluded people in over 40 countries worldwide to secure their rights to a life free of poverty and injustice, and with the support of half a million donors and supporters.

The Position :
The Country Director (CD) provides vision, leadership, management and effective high-level national representation for ActionAid International in Burundi, in line with the established policies, principles and operating practices of ActionAid International, as well as good management practice and the political, social, cultural and economic environment of Burundi. The CD is also responsible for overseeing the implementation of the ActionAid Burundi Country Strategy Paper (CSP). The CD role requires broadorganizational experience to develop and manage a growing team well as deep knowledge of Burundi to make significant improvements to policies and processes that to the lead long-term success of ActionAid in Burundi.
